摘要
The paper deals with the analysis on the innovative approaches in the accounting and audit of the book value of assets. The results of analyses proved that of the book value of assets in the accounting and audit, especially in the context of financial crises, implementation of the new or modified standard of accounting and reporting becomes an important part of the issues. Herewith, financial and management decision, which compare book and market value, hying to predict the future (fair) value of assets or even a company (firm). The main goal of the paper is analysed of the tendency in the scientific literature on the accounting and audit of the book value of assets to identify future research directions. For the analysis, the VOSviewer and Scopus tools were used. This study reviews 714 papers from the Scopus database. The time for analysis was all timeline of the Scopus database. The results showed the growing tendency in publishing the documents in the Scopus database focused on the accounting and audit of the book value of assets issues. It began to increase from 1997 to 1999, from 2007 to 2009, and from 2014 to 2017. Moreover, the focus of investigation moved from general issues to problem of the fair value of assets, implementation of modifying standards of reporting and accounting. In 2018, the number of documents increased by 1225% compared to 1997. It was the year with the biggest number of paper devoted to analysing the innovative approaches in the accounting and audit of the book value of assets. Mostly the innovative approaches in the accounting and audit of the book value of assets were analysed under the subject area as follows: Business, Management and Accounting; Economics, Econometrics and Finance; Social Sciences; Engineering. Besides, the biggest share of the scientists which investigated issues the innovative approaches in the accounting and audit of the book value of assets was from the USA, United Kingdom, Australia and China. In 2019 papers focused on analyses of the innovative approaches in the accounting and audit of the book value of assets were published in journals with high impact factor as follows: Contemporary Accounting Research, Accounting Review, International Journal of Accounting, Managerial Finance, Accounting And Business Research. Such results proved that theme on the innovative approaches in the accounting and audit of the book value of assets is actually in the ongoing trends of the modern accounting, finance, management and audit. The findings from VOSviewer identified 6 clusters of the papers which investigated innovative approaches in the accounting and audit of the book value of assets from the different points of views. The first most significant cluster merged the keywords as follows: accounting information, fair value, financial reporting, fair value accounting, firm value, intangible assets, intellectual capital etc. The second biggest cluster merged the keywords as follows: costs, cost accounting, accounting method, assets value, assets valuation, depreciation, cost-benefit analyse, balance sheet etc. The third biggest cluster focused on criminal aspects of value relevance, book value, the book value of equity, equity valuation, earnings, dividend etc. Such tendency allows making a conclusion, financial and management decision, which compare book and market value, trying to predict future (fair) value of assets or even a company (firm) are very close and popular in different issues.
